Issues installing A6150 wifi USB adapter in Windows 10

Hi,

I am trying to setup Netgear A6150 wifi usb adapter for Windows 10, it says I have to install software from the link below and then insert the device. When I am doing so I am getting the device in the Device Manager in Windows by without any drivers, see the screenshot below. Have tried to reinstall many times and restarted PC in between, all the same.

I don't see anywhere possibility to download any drivers in form of INF file to point Windows to.

Re: Issues installing A6150 wifi USB adapter in Windows 10

Expand the A6150_Windows_Standalone_V1.0.0.5.zip

 

A6150 Windows Standalone V1.0.0.5.PNG

 

Then run the A6150_Windows_Standalone_V1.0.0.5.exe, and you get everything required in C:\Program Files (x86)\NETGEAR\NETGEAR A6150 Genie\Drivers 

 

NETGEAR A6150 Genie pxld.PNG

 

Point Windows to this folder with the netrtwlanu.inf and up you go.
